Hello,
A gap taken for MBA exams preparations is quite common nowadays, so it's not really an issue. However, one should make the most of this gap time by utilizing it for other activities like certification courses, internships, social work, etc. These activities will ensure you edge over the other freshers (in terms of the resume) and also highlight your interest in past academics and/or future MBA stream. A gap taken solely for the exam preparations might create a negative impact on the interviewers, as these exams generally require 3-4 hours daily.
